About This School
Sylvio J Gilbert School is a middle school located in Augusta, Maine. The school serves 335 students in grades -1-6. The student-to-teacher ratio is 14.6:1.
According to EDFacts assessment data, 50% of students meet grade-level proficiency standards in combined math and reading.
57%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ch.
Sylvio J Gilbert School is part of the Augusta Public Schools in Maine. The school receives Title I federal funding.
How This School Compares
Sylvio J Gilbert School has 335 students enrolled, making it smaller than the average school in Augusta Public Schools (369 students). Its 50% proficiency rate is 0 percentage points above the district average of 50%. Compared to the Maine state average of 54%, the school performs 4 points lower. With a 14.6:1 student-teacher ratio, it offers smaller class sizes than the national average.
